Hi - I have a small flock in MD. I have had some experience with Black Sex Links, Production Reds, and Golden Laced Wyandottes. My laying flock was usually less than 5 and right now I have 2 - a RP and GLW.

I also just recently got 4 baby Black Copper Marans from a local hatchery northeast of Baltimore. They are not so baby anymore - in fact they are about 9.5 weeks and looking more like adult chickens every day. I am hoping to build my BCM flock for eggs and hopefully even for show and breeders toward the SOP.

I am having some issues with sexing my juvies - pretty sure I have at least 1 roo (possibly overcoloted) and 2 pullets. I can’t tell on the black one with the large, red comb. I have had chickens in other breeds with big combs as juvies that ended up being hens after all!
